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Facilities and Accessibility

Portsmouth Harbour Station is designed to offer convenience and accessibility to all its passengers. Open from 05:50 to 19:00 on weekdays, slightly adjusted on weekends, the ticket office ensures travelers can purchase and collect tickets with ease. Modern ticket machines support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, offering additional assistance for passengers with disabilities.

The station embraces inclusivity with features like step-free access parts, although certain areas require a ramp or the use of a footbridge. Important amenities such as accessible toilets and induction loops are present to support passengers' needs further. While there is no formal waiting room, ample seating areas are provided for comfort while you await your train.

Travel Connections

Portsmouth Harbour Station is a gateway to various transportation options, making it easy to continue your journey past the train station. From two convenient "Beryl Bikes" hire points for cycling enthusiasts to accessible bus connections to Southsea Hoverport, including the Hoverbus (H1) departing from Stand C, the station efficiently blends with Portsmouth's local transport network. Even in instances of rail disruptions, rail replacement services operate out of nearby Hard Interchange Stands, ensuring smooth travel.

Facilities and Amenities

While Alresford (Essex) train station lacks a dedicated ticket office, there are ticket machines available for both purchase and collection, ensuring a quick and seamless travel experience. It's also noteworthy that smartcard holders can use the validators here. Accessibility has not been overlooked, with induction loops and step-free access being available, making the station navigable for everyone.

For your security and convenience, the station is equipped with CCTV, but you'll need to plan ahead as it lacks amenities such as a waiting room, toilets, or refreshment facilities. However, you can find seating areas and help points on the platform for any immediate assistance.

Travel Connections

Moving beyond the station is effortless thanks to well-placed rail replacement bus services and local bus routes. There are direct buses available that transport you to nearby destinations such as Colchester, Clacton, and Brightlingsea, providing flexible travel for both work and leisure.
